How does the high-desert climate of Glenns Ferry, ID, affect long-term boat storage, and what specific precautions should I take?
Glenns Ferry's semi-arid climate features hot, dry summers and cold winters with occasional snow, which presents unique challenges. For long-term storage, sun exposure is a major concern; using a high-quality UV-protective cover is essential to prevent gel coat and upholstery damage. Winterization is critical due to freezing temperatures; you must properly winterize the engine, freshwater systems, and livewells to prevent cracking. The dry air can cause seals and hoses to become brittle, so consider using protectants. Dust and wind are also factors, so a tight-fitting cover and possibly indoor or covered storage are advisable to minimize abrasive dust accumulation on your boat's surfaces.
Are there specific regulations or permits required for storing a boat on my own property in Glenns Ferry, ID?
Yes, regulations in Glenns Ferry and Elmore County can affect on-property boat storage. While it's often permitted, you should check local zoning ordinances, which may have restrictions on storing large boats, especially in residential areas, regarding visibility from the street or proximity to property lines. There are typically no specific 'boat storage permits,' but if you plan to build a permanent storage structure like a large shed, you'll need a building permit from the city or county. Always contact the Glenns Ferry City Hall or Elmore County Planning and Zoning to verify current rules, as they can vary based on your property's specific zoning designation (e.g., residential, agricultural).

As a Glenns Ferry boat owner, what security features should I prioritize when choosing a storage facility?
Given Glenns Ferry's rural setting, prioritizing security is wise. Look for facilities with robust features such as 24/7 gated access with personalized entry codes, well-lit premises, and perimeter fencing. Video surveillance covering key areas like entry points and storage rows is a significant deterrent. Some local facilities may also offer individual unit alarms. Given the value of boats and equipment, inquire if the facility has on-site management or regular security patrols. Additionally, check that your storage contract clearly outlines the facility's liability and your insurance responsibilities. A secure facility provides peace of mind, especially during the off-season when your boat is stored for extended periods.
